You've probably experienced what it's like to be locked out of your vehicle without the proper tools. You could cause damage to your vehicle and cause alarms by trying to force your key into the lock, or break it.

Auto locksmiths can be of assistance. They can do everything from creating a brand new key to changing the ignition switch for you.

Losing Your Keys

It's a pain is to lose your keys. It's one of those events that occurs at the moment you least expect it and it can be quite a struggle to get back up from it. There are a few steps you could take to ensure that your keys won't disappear again.

Make sure you have a spare. It is always a good idea to have a backup plan in the event that something happens to your main key. Fortunately, most locksmiths can provide this service. It is also worth considering upgrading your home security system. There are many options, from keyless entry systems to full alarms. A locksmith keys in car in your area can assist you in enhancing your security by providing you with information on the different options available and assisting you in choosing which one is right for you.

Searching in places you may not have considered is a different step. The key is often hidden from view. If you still can't find it, seek help from someone close to you or a friend. Having a fresh set of eyes can be very helpful, and they may remember seeing your keys in a location you didn't think of.

Be sure to check under the mats that cover the floor. Some keys may get stuck in the mats or in the small black holes inside the center console that are large enough to swallow a tiny key.

If you can, also contact the dealer. The dealer might be able to create a key for your based on the VIN and proof of ownership. However, this can be costly and time-consuming. Dealerships are often required to purchase keys from the manufacturer. This could take days or even weeks.

A locksmith might be able to assist you if not content with the price or turnaround time at your dealership. But you must do your research first, because certain locksmiths may not be legitimate. Do not hire anyone to replace your lock or drills into it. Only work with licensed businesses.

Locked out

It can be dangerous to keep your pets or children inside the car if it's locked. It is important to stay calm in this situation and figure out how to get back inside your vehicle without causing any damage. The first thing you need to do is contact an acquaintance or family member who will give you the spare key. If this does not work, you should try to employ a tool such as a wire hanger or a shoestring to open the door. Avoid breaking the window of your car unless it is an emergency. This could lead to costly repairs and injuries.

If none of these options are working, it's time to call a professional locksmith. They'll have all the tools required to open your vehicle quickly and efficiently, without causing damage. They can open the lock or reprogram the keys according to the kind of security is in place. They might have a tool that opens the car when the key is broken or lost in the ignition.

You can also call roadside assistance for help unlocking your car. This service is offered by auto insurance companies, car clubs and a few credit card companies. These services typically cost you an amount to unlock your vehicle, but they can save you from a lot of hassle if you are ever stuck in a pickle.

In the event of an emergency, you should always keep an extra key handy and put it somewhere you or someone you can trust to quickly access it. You can avoid many headaches by keeping a spare key in your purse, wallet or in a safe place at home. It is also important to buy a car with security features that stop lockouts. Broken Keys

Over time, keys break due to normal wear and wear and tear. Sometimes, the key cylinder is stuck in the lock and isn't an easy problem to fix. There are some ways to remove the key and back inside the lock without damaging it.

One of the first things you can try is to lubricate the keyhole with oil or powder. This will lessen friction points that hold the piece in place and make it easier to remove from the lock. If you don't have any lubricant on hand, a thin wire like a paperclip can work as well. You can bend the ends to help you grab the broken part of the key.

If the piece of broken key sticks out far enough, you can use needle nose pliers and pull it. If not you can try wriggling it and playing with it until a part of it breaks. If you put too much pressure, it may cause further damage.

A small saw blade can also be used to extract the key fragment. Simply insert the blade into the lock cylinder, align it with the teeth on the key fragment that is broken and then gently pull it out. This technique is extremely delicate and could damage the lock if not done correctly.

For very stubborn or badly damaged locks locksmiths may be required. Professional locksmiths can find even the most difficult keys without damaging the lock.

You can also use superglue to tie together the two pieces of the broken key. This is a very risky method, as you'll need to apply a tiny amount of glue on the exposed part of the key, and then carefully insert it into the lock as straight as you can. This will cause the two components to collide and eventually release it from the lock. Don't turn the key, as this could squish out the glue and cover up important components.

Rekeying

Rekeying is the process of changing a lock so that it works with a different lock key. This is typically done when moving into a new residence but it can also be an excellent security measure for vehicles. Rekeying locks is cheaper than changing locks, locksmiths for cars Near me and can make it harder for burglars.

Locksmiths for automobiles have the expertise and tools to change the key of a car lock without further causing damage. They can also help you with other security measures, such as installing an alarm. A car alarm is designed to alert you in the event that your vehicle has been compromised, making it more difficult for criminals to rob your property. It also serves as a deterrent for thieves because it could make them be more cautious about trying to steal your car.

It is recommended to leave the process of rekeying your car to professionals unless you are an experienced locksmith for cars keys. If you try it yourself, you might harm the handle, the window or the door frame. It's also risky to work on a car lock if it's not disconnected from the ignition. This could cause the vehicle to stop and could harm the key switch as well as other safety features.

The majority of locksmiths are highly skilled and well-trained. They are knowledgeable about the various keys, locks and security features of automobiles. They also understand how to work with different types of locks, such as the latest high-security models. Locksmiths also have a range of tools and equipment. They also have various options such as reprogramming keys, or creating replacement keys that are laser-cut.

Locksmiths can also extract a broken key or a bent one from the lock. They can make use of a thin ruler made of steel known as a "slim jim" to access the lock and remove the key. It is important to not force a bent or broken key, as it could damage the lock, which is expensive to replace.

Contact a locksmith if you can't remove a broken or bent key. They can change the key on your car's locks, giving you complete control over who can access it. They can also set up a security system for cars and design laser-cut keys that can be programmed.
